This report is an analysis of the intellectual property rights (IPR) issues associated with student created work in UK further and higher education. Initial research showed that the majority of UK higher education institutions have relevant policies, but many of these lack detail in dealing with the variety of situations which may arise. The research showed no evidence of relevant policies within the further education sector as yet.
This report has been produced as the result of a project undertaken by JISC Legal for the JISC Development IPR Consultancy from September to December 2006. The report in pdf format can be accessed here - JISC Legal Investigation into Student Work and IPR.
